Summary Explanation/Background
PUBLIC WORKS DEPARTMENT/HIGHWAY CONSTRUCTION AND ENGINEERING DIVISION RECOMMENDS APPROVAL.
McNab Road is a County road in the City of North Lauderdale. The City of North Lauderdale desires to install and maintain a city monument sign within County right-of-way on the north side of McNab Road, approximately 600 feet west of the west limits of the Florida Turnpike (“Revocable License Area”).
This Item seeks Board approval of a Revocable License Agreement (“Agreement”) between Broward County (“County”) and the City of North Lauderdale (“City”) for the installation and maintenance of a city monument sign within Broward County right-of-way on the north side of McNab Road, approximately 600 feet west of the west limits of the Florida Turnpike (Exhibit 1). Exhibit 2 is a location map of this Revocable License Area.
The Agreement will allow the City to install the sign within County right-of-way and will obligate the City to maintain the sign. The County can terminate the Agreement with or without cause at any time. If the Agreement is terminated, the City must remove all improvements within the Revocable License Area and restore same to its original condition or to such condition as approved in writing by the Contract Administrator.
The Agreement has been reviewed and approved as to form by the Office of the County Attorney.
